Kathleen Smithers – Critical Studies in Education, 2024
Schools in southern Africa use tourism partnerships as a source for establishing philanthropic funding and philanthropic networks. In these partnerships, there is often an exchange of funds for use of the school for tourism purposes. Little is known about the influence of tourism on schools. Moyo, Nathan; Gonye, Jairos – Pedagogy, Culture and Society, 2015
This study reframes Yvonne Vera's novel, "The Stone Virgins" as a potential secondary school literature text in the Zimbabwean curriculum through which a pedagogy of expiation could be re-imagined.
